JUDGMENT
These writ petitions are connected and therefore, I am disposing these writ petitions by a common judgment.
2. When these writ petitions came up for consideration on 01.08.2022, this Court passed the following
order:
“In both these writ petitions, the petitioners challenge the proceedings dated 16.9.2019 issued by the Corporate Manager.
2. I have heard Sri.M.Sajjad, the learned
counsel appearing for the petitioner in W.P.(C) No.17217 of 2021, Sri.Jagan Abraham M. George, the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ner in W.P.(C) No.24464 of 2021, the learned Government Pleader and the learned counsel appearing for the Corporate Manager.
3. It appears that the Sangeetha Society Management Corporate Aided Schools acquire ALPS, Ramassery, and the same was approved by the Government by Ext.P3 order produced in W.P.(C)
No.17217 of 2021. In terms of the provisions of Rule 36 Chapter XIV of the KER, the teachers of the existing school and the teachers in the newly transferred school are required to be integrated according to the length of their continuous service. The Manager in terms of the advice obtained by him had issued proceedings dated 16.9.2019 as per which, the petitioners in both these cases, along with another teacher, were ordered to be retrenched to accommodate certain teachers who were retrenched before the transfer of the school to the new management. The petitioner in both these cases contends that the order passed by the Manager cannot be sustained under law.
4. The counsel appearing for the Corporate
Manager refers to Rule 36A, and it is argued that when schools under one educational agency are transferred to another educational agency with the approval of the competent authority, the various categories of teachers who are so transferred are required to be integrated with the respondent categories of teachers who are already working from the date of transfer in the schools under the educational agency to which the transfer is made. The common seniority of all teachers of the school so transferred and the schools existing under the educational agency to which the transfer is made on the date of transfer is required to be decided on the length of continuous service of all such teachers
transferred to the educational agency and existing under it on the date of transfer subject to Rule 36 and Sub-rule 2 of Rule 37. According to the learned counsel appearing for the Corporate Manager, some clarity is required to resolve the issue. However, since the writ petition was filed, the proceedings have not been forwarded to the DGE.
5. The learned Government Pleader on
instructions submits that the proceedings of the Manager dated 28.9.2019 is to be forwarded to the DGE concerned, and a decision has to be taken. Having regard to the submissions advanced, there will be a direction to the Corporate Manager to forward Ext.P5 proceedings in W.P.(C) No.17217 of 2021 and Ext.P9 proceedings in W.P.(C) No.24464 of 2021 to the 2nd respondent within a period of one week from today. The 2nd respondent shall consider the action taken by the Manager and take appropriate decision thereon within a further period of one month.“
3. Based on the above order, the Corporate Manager
forwarded Exts.P5 and P9 proceedings in these cases to the Director of General Education and based on the same, the Director of General Education passed an order bearing No.G1/12174/2022/D.G.E dated 13.01.2023. In the light of the same, nothing survives in these cases, except to take consequential steps based on the above order. Therefore, these writ petitions are disposed of in the following manner:
1. The competent authority among the respondents
will take consequential steps based on order
bearing No.G1/12174/2022/D.G.E dated 13.01.2023, as expeditiously as possible, at any rate, within six we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this judgment.
